Morning: Start your day by visiting the historic district of Al Fahidi, commonly known as Bastakiya. Explore the narrow lanes lined with traditional Arabian architecture, visit the Dubai Museum located in the Al Fahidi Fort, and learn about the city's history. Wander through the vibrant spice and gold souks in Deira in the afternoon, where you can bargain for unique souvenirs and indulge in the local flavors. In the evening, head to Al Seef, a promenade along Dubai Creek, lined with shops, restaurants, and waterfront cafes.

When in Dubai, don't miss out on exploring the lesser-known attractions loved by locals. Visit the atmospheric neighborhood of Alserkal Cultural Foundation, filled with independent boutiques, art galleries, and trendy cafes. Explore the Dubai Creek area by taking an abra (traditional boat) ride, offering stunning views of the city's skyline and revealing a glimpse of Dubai's trading history. To experience the local food scene, head to the Al Dhiyafah Road in Satwa, which is famous for its affordable and authentic international cuisine.
